Top job projections for graduates in educational leadership and administration from southeastern louisiana university
Education administrators, postsecondary
Projection Rating: A-
Median Annual Wage: $102,610
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 9.91%-7.38%
Employment Change: 6.2%
Entry-Level Education: Master's degree
Education administrators, kindergarten through secondary
Projection Rating: A-
Median Annual Wage: $103,460
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 9.83%-7.32%
Employment Change: -1.6%
Entry-Level Education: Master's degree

This projection assumes you are taking out a Direct Subsidized loan (using the current federal interest rate) with a 12 year Standard Fixed repayment plan on the total yearly tuition (four years if Bachelor's degree, six for Master's degree and 12 for Doctorate) of your chosen institution.
